Berdan: Mr. and Mrs. John T. Berdan, November 1932

Photograph
Press photograph. Label reads: "Mr. and Mrs. John T. Berdan of Short Hills, NJ. loll in the sunshine at the Belmont Hotel in Bermuda, where they are vacationing. November 5, 1932. The Berdan's lived on Parsonage Hill Road. Their social activities were tracked closely in the Item of Millburn-Short Hills in the 1930s-1944, when they moved with their two children, Sonja and Temple, from Short Hills to Pasadena, California.
